Hornets Sweep Past Volleyball Women

The Eastern Mennonite women's volleyball team hosted Lynchburg Saturday afternoon in Harrisonburg.  Both teams had played the previous evening, but the Hornets had more energy in a 3-0 sweep.

The Lady Royals had a 10-8 lead in game one before faltering to a 25-18 finish.  The Hornets skipped to a 6-1 cushion in game two and never looked back, 25-19.

The teams battled evenly early in game three before Lynchburg closed things out on a 14-4 run for a 25-13 score.

Kyle Moorefield (Danville, VA/Tunstall) led EMU with five kills and five service aces.  Tabitha Bowman (Waynesboro, VA/Stuarts Draft) also have five kills with one solo block.

Mattie Lehman (New Paris, IN/Bethany Christian) split time between setter and libero and finished with team highs of nine digs and seven assists.

With the loss the Lady Royals slide to 3-9 overall and 0-3 in the ODAC.  Their four-match homestand continues next week with Virginia Wesleyan on Tuesday and Shenandoah on Thursday.
